Privacy and Anonymity in Usernames

Privacy is very important when it comes to usernames. The internet we frequent today, sadly, is one where oversharing is commonplace and can be dangerous. Usernames can provide people with a protective barrier from the world. In this case, “KerryFinlay87” comes across as a name we can recognize yet does not reveal specific information that could put that person at risk. This is a good example of anonymity with balance.

When users create a pseudonym, they are able to engage in conversations, play games, give their opinions, and engage without exposing their entire identity. This balance is critical for online safety and managing your digital reputation. It lets users determine how much they want to share with others and how much they want to keep private.

The Cultural Role of Numbers in Usernames

Numbers that are appended onto usernames are more than just filler. They usually hold personal meaning, such as birth dates and lucky numbers. The “87” in “KerryFinlay87” could easily signal a birth year. It could also be referencing a sports number, favorite year or simply a code that holds personal significance. 

In online culture, numbers helped make usernames unique. There is a desire for individuality and numbers also allow users the ability to identify themselves a bit more subtly at the same time. It globalizes the name and, in a sense, recognizes itself as an individual while acknowledging a larger collective.
